  1. Footnotes. References. External links. Heinrich, Count of Württemberg. Henry of Württemberg (7 September 1448 – 15 April 1519) was, from 1473 to 1482, count of Montbéliard . Life. Henry was the second son of Count Ulrich V of Württemberg-Stuttgart from his second marriage to Elisabeth of Bavaria-Landshut. [1] .

  3. This is a list of monarchs of Württemberg, containing the Counts, Dukes, Electors, and Kings who reigned over different territories named Württemberg from the beginning of the County of Württemberg in the 11th century to the end of the Kingdom of Württemberg in 1918.
